About the role:
We have an excellent opportunity for a Mechanical Technician to join our Maintenance team at our Beckton Sewage Treatment Works (STW). As the successful candidate, your role will be to ensure that all equipment at our waste treatment works is running safely and efficiently using proactive and reactive maintenance methods. What you’ll be doing as the Mechanical Technician
- Investigate plant failures and perform repairs as quickly and efficiently as possible to avoid interruptions to the process. This may involve investigating and diagnosing complex faults and performing repairs during incidents.
- You will be expected to provide technical advice, refer to up-to-date technical knowledge, and provide training or support for technical trainees if required.
- Examples of equipment that you will be working on include motors, gearboxes, screw /chain conveyors & centrifuges, various pumps, and associated control gear, 3-phase motors, starters, automatic valves, flow, level and pressure measurement, programmable, chemical handling, and dosing equipment.
- Completing statutory checks as required.
- Always working safely and complying with all Health and Safety guidance and procedures.

What you should bring to the role
- ONC/HNC in engineering, NVQ, or C&G level 3 in mechanical engineering qualification in Mechanical Engineering is crucial.
- Knowledge and awareness of health and safety issues are crucial.
- The work will require physical fitness, as you will work in confined spaces with the successful completion of the appropriate training.
- A valid driving licence is essential, and all necessary equipment, such as the vehicle and tools, are provided.
